Basileios I de Macedoniër (Grieks: Βασίλειος; Latijn: Basilius) (Thracië, 827 – Constantinopel, 29 augustus 886), was Byzantijns keizer (867 tot 886) van Armeense afkomst en stichter van de Macedonische dynastie (867–1056). Hij klom geleidelijk op van de boerenschuur naar de troonzaal, dankzij keizer Michaël III, een alcoholist wiens vriendschap en vertrouwen hij won, maar die hij in 867 uit de weg liet ruimen. Daarvoor had hij ook al diens oom Bardas, broer en adviseur van Michaels moeder, keizerin Theodora II, in 866 laten vermoorden. Basileios huwde de langdurige minnares van Michael III, Eudokia Ingerina, met wie hij drie kinderen kreeg. Lees meer op Wikipedia
